DAVID DARREL NOER

DAVID DARREL NOER

Born In: Kamloops, British Columbia, Canada
Born: January 24th, 1961

Passed on: April 10th, 2013

It is with deep sadness we announce the sudden passing of David at the age of 52.

David was born in Kamloops, B.C. and lived with his parents and siblings in Clearwater until age 5. Following his mother's passing, David moved to Kamloops and was cared for by Irene Crowson and her husband until the age of 18. In April 1994, he moved to Interior Community Services Centennial House which he called home for the past 19 years.

David was an active volunteer with the SPCA for 22 years and received the Provincial Volunteer of the Year award in 2002. He also actively participated in Special Olympics, volunteered at the Kamloops Food Bank, held a position as a board member for the Kamloops branch of the Canadian Association for the Mentally Ill, cleaned the streets of Tranquille 3 days a week as well as the Northills Mall bus loop through his employment at Smart Options. He will be fondly remembered for his ready smile and contagious giggle.

His kind and generous spirit touched all who knew him...especially his soul mate Ann Marie.

David was predeceased by his mother Mary Barbara (Jean), brothers John and Louis, and sisters Phyllis and Darlene.

He is survived by his father Victor as well as his three sisters Rose, Cindy and Jeannie.

He also leaves behind his niece Becky (Jeff) and great-nephews Braden and Luke. Also feeling his loss are his Uncles Mel, Vic and Walter as well as his cousin Mike.

He was Dearly Loved by his family and he will be sadly missed
by all who knew him.

David loved animals and had a beautiful tender heart and respect for all of God's Creation.
